You've heard his name mentioned in the BIOs of Team Sakara, now meet the villain behind that name:

Dr. E-VOK ROBOTNIK

REAL NAME: Eron Artimus Kintobor
AGE: Unknown; physically appears as late 30s to early to mid 40s
HEIGHT: 6'2"
WEIGHT: 200 Lbs
SPECIES: Human Overlord/29th century Borg hybrid
BIRTH: Unknown; presumed to be around or before the 2830s

BIO:
Much of Eron's true past is shrouded in mystery, but from intel reports gathered, it is suggested that Eron Artimus Kintobor's last name was really Robotnik, and that he is descendant from the great criminal mastermind Dr. Ivo "Eggman" Robotnik of the planet Mobius. According to sources and Intel gather thus far, Eron was born sometime at the beginning of the 29th century. Parents are unknown, as he was found as a baby at the doorstep of an orphanage on a colony on Vigis II, located at the time near Borg space. During this time period, the liberated Borg Cooperative outnumbered the evil Borg Collective in population by about 2-to-1, leading the Collective to try and spread out in small grounds to try and assimilate other worlds in order to increase their numbers.
When Eron Kintobor was in his late teens, the Borg Collective came to Vigis II and assimilated most of the colony, including him. Unfortunately for the Borg, Eron was found with robotizied implants and nanites within his system when he was a baby, and these nanties were design to overaid borg technology and reprogram them to follow his commands & suit his own needs. Thus, While Eron did play a convincing 29th century borg drone for quite a time, it turned out he still had his individuality intact, and was just playing along to buy his time until ready to strike and take over the collective as his own.
During a battle between the Borg Queen & Cooperative factions, Eron played his "trump card," by single-handedly affecting all Borg drones within the Queen's ship to follow his will using his own Robo-nanites, and starting a coup to overtake the ship. He then killed off the Queen himself. Following the successful takeover of the ship, Eron began to spread his Overaid Robo-Nanites to any Cooperative Borg that were still on board or captured for reassimilation and send them back to the Cooperative ships, effecting them with the nanites as well, and thus re-assimilating & reprogramming all Borg on both sides of the battlefield to serve only him. After this incident, Eron Kintobor became Dr. E-Vok Robotnik, and soon began a campaign to conqur anyone & everyone who refused his rule.
It isn't know until years later that during his time playing Borg Drone, the Robo-Nanites in his brain & blood stream started giving him long detailed information on his origins, as well as his family's legacy. Turns out his parents, now long dead, were earlier descendants of Eggman who wanted nothing to do with the Robotnik legacy, and wanted to change for the better, thus leaving the family Empire behind and changing their name back to Kintobor to conceal their past. Wanting to place his true family name once again in history, Eron decided to embrace his ancestor's dark legacy, and once again carry the name Robotnik.
Since then, E-Vok has been trying time and again to attack the federation and its allies, using any means necessary to take them out, while also trying to reconquer the planet Mobius & rebuilt Robotroplious.
Once the Temporal Cold War started, E-Vok immediately took up arms with his army of Robo-Borg Drones and robotizied spies to change history to meet his goals (including trying to take out Sonic the Hedgehog & Princess Sally Acorn before they could end Dr. Eggman's original reign), only for Team Sakara and the crew of the Axalon to foil his plans and preserve the time stream.
During one temporal incursion in the war, it was discovered that Eron's rise into E-Vok was in fact a self-fulfilling paradox: It is discovered that E-vok went back in time personally to the day of his birth, and killed his own parents. He then took his newborn self and injected him with the robo-nanites he had just developed, and transported him to the orphanage, and thus setting himself up for his long awaiting career of evil.
To this day, E-Vok continues to meddle with the timelines of not just the Federation and planet Mobius, but any world or people of interest whose changed history would work to his favor, making him both a terrorists & temporal threat not to be reckoned with.

The design I had in mind for E-Vok came from several sources, including Shinzon from Star Trek Nemesis, Cypher from The Matrix, and One, the 29th Borg Drone from the Star Trek Voyager ep., "Drone" (in fact, his Borg armor is a direct redesign of One's adaptive organic armor). Tim Curry and his "evil villain" persona was also a factor in his design.

Where as Dr. Robotnik & Dr. Eggman were depicted as fat heavy power houses, for E-Vok I wanted to go in the opposite direction and made him skinny & stronge, so that with his Borg strength & abilities he would have the speed & power to rival Team Sakara evenly in combat.

Both his Borg Armor's colors & his lab-coat's colors & design are a nod to the Robotniks that came before him, including Eggman Nega. The gold ring "plugs" on his lab coat & armor allow him to connect to Borg suspension cables, much like the Borg Queen. And both armor hands come with nanite tubules for both assimilation & computer hacking. His left ocular implant has the Borg insignia as part of the scanning device's design.
